I know, bump, but I was having the same issue as Naryar, on all kinds of RA2 versions, using the normal and a custom version I made. At first I thought the .exe was outdated(in the credits it still says the .exe is version 1.2), ran the patcher and found out that the 1.3 patch doesn't add a new .exe.
After seeing the issue in Ironforge I quickly thought that it had to do with the compatibility settings and removed them all. That worked and further testing showed that the "run as administrator" flag caused the issue(guess the program is run under the admin user account which autohotkey can't send keys to/since it's started by a normal user it's not running on the admin.)
Just thought I'd add this for people having the same issue, hope this isn't a negative bump.
